> The x3d script node can either in/out data using routes or directly
> to/from another node no route using direct out.
>
> The only difference is that directout do not initiate a cascade because no
> route.

> >> All field type constructors and methods are defined fields.js . Since
> x3dom is operating together with other scripts on the page everything needs
> to be namespaced. Instead of
> >>
> >> new MFInt32()
> >>
> >> there is a
> >>
> >> new x3dom.fields.MFInt32()
> >>
> >> I think John added appropriate helpers which should work in an
> encapsulated function scope under which all X3Dscripts execute.
